Output 70125340565c2ce6304efd3353837206eecee586d318e67aefbaa64b944942af:4
- value
- 1594323
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ed3a475ff9557606f7615d6eafb3612dd10e4b38
- address
- tb1qa5aywhle24mqdampt4h2lvmp9hgsujecvl55gu
- transaction
- 70125340565c2ce6304efd3353837206eecee586d318e67aefbaa64b944942af